Location and Meeting Details
The wine tasting experience takes place in San Casciano in Val di Pesa, a charming town located in the heart of the Florentine countryside, approximately 18 kilometers southwest of Florence.
The meeting point is at Via di Perseto, 20, and the tour ends back at the same location. Participants should confirm the start time with the local provider in advance, as the experience is offered on Mondays and Wednesdays from 10:30 AM to 12:00 PM.
The wine tasting is accessible to wheelchair users and those with strollers, and service animals are welcome.
